Output 269dfc58dfb7a8ef6810dc466dd93fa1ae10344cca86c8ee0a383281f2e2905e:1

value
40150643
script pubkey
OP_0 OP_PUSHBYTES_20 4f86233ef68e4fcd03fab7aed6d12840e0078834
address
tb1qf7rzx0hk3e8u6ql6k7hdd5fggrsq0zp5xs07d2
transaction
269dfc58dfb7a8ef6810dc466dd93fa1ae10344cca86c8ee0a383281f2e2905e
confirmations
67270
spent
true